About Course
Golf Club At Oxford Greens is a public 18-hole golf course located in Oxford, Connecticut. Designed by architect Mark Mungeam in 2004, the course features bent grass greens and fairways. The facility offers golfers a comprehensive practice environment with a driving range and on-site golf school. Visitors can access professional instruction through the teaching pro available at the course. Situated in the northeastern United States, this course provides a standard public golf experience for players seeking a well-maintained playing surface and additional training resources. The course represents a modern golf facility constructed in the early 2000s to serve local and regional golf enthusiasts.

Frequently Asked Questions
How many holes does Golf Club at Oxford Greens have?
Golf Club at Oxford Greens in Oxford, Connecticut is a 18-hole golf course.
What are the par and rating at Golf Club at Oxford Greens?
Golf Club at Oxford Greens plays to a par of 72, has a course rating of 75.4, carries a slope rating of 135.
Is Golf Club at Oxford Greens public or private?
Golf Club at Oxford Greens is a public golf course.
Who designed Golf Club at Oxford Greens and when did it open?
Golf Club at Oxford Greens was designed by Mark Mungeam (2004) and opened in 2004.
